EEA (Ethylene Ethyl-acrylate Copolymer) is the special elastomer which have a good thermal stability and non-corrosive to metals. It is used as a base resin for semi-conductive compounds and flame retardant compounds used in power cables, or in other electrical materials applications, and is also used as a modifier for engineering plastics. It is also widely used as an asphalt modifier in waterproof sheets for highway bridges.
